→ The gases in Earth's mantle are released during what events?

Respuesta :

JNIEWU173 JNIEWU173
  • 11-06-2021
Earth's mantle has kept contributing to the Earth's atmosphere through a process called degassing. During this process, gases are emitted from the magma in the mantle and are transferred into the atmosphere through tectonic procedure such as ocean ridge spreading and volcanism.
